The Triple Threat: How Oil Volatility, Geopolitical Friction, and Rate Uncertainty Are Shaping the 2026 Outlook
A confluence of energy price spikes, geopolitical instability in the Strait of Hormuz, and diverging central bank policies has triggered a wave of recessionary warnings. As analysts compare current market conditions to the 2008 financial crisis, the Federal Reserve faces an increasingly narrow path to a soft landing.
